5,963,577,878,729,437 is an odd composite number composed of three prime numbers multiplied together.

What does the number 5963577878729437 look like?

This visualization shows the relationship between its 3 prime factors (large circles) and 8 divisors.

5963577878729437 is an odd composite number. It is composed of three dist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of eight divisors.

Prime factorization of 5963577878729437:

37 × 354763 × 454325227
